Inspector Simon Garrett is the Neighbourhood Policing Inspector for the Devizes, Marlborough and Pewsey areas.

With over 24 years of policing experience - 21 of those spent with Wiltshire Police - Simon has served in a wide variety of roles across the county. His background includes a strong focus on frontline policing as well as time spent in custody roles, including the delivery of specialist training.

Simon is passionate about the impact Neighbourhood Policing can have on local communities. He believes it offers a valuable opportunity to proactively target crime hotspots, reduce offending, and provide tailored support to the most vulnerable members of the public.

Leading the local Neighbourhood Team is a role Simon describes as a privilege. He is committed to making a meaningful difference in the communities he serves and ensuring his team delivers the highest possible standard of service.

Sergeant Georgie Wyatt is the Neighbourhood Sergeant overseeing the areas of Devizes, Marlborough, and Pewsey. She began her career with Wiltshire Police in 2014 as a detention officer before joining as a Police Constable in 2016.

Georgie initially policed Trowbridge in a uniformed role before transitioning into detective work. She spent around five years as a detective, gaining experience in both main office CID and proactive policing. Following this, she took on the role of managing a response team in Devizes.

Driven by a passion for community-focused policing, Georgie made the decision to join the neighbourhood team, where she now leads efforts to build strong community relationships and address local issues. Her broad policing experience and leadership make her a valued asset to the communities she serves.

PC Nicky Crabbe is a Neighbourhood Officer covering the rural areas around Devizes. She is part of a close-knit team that supports one another across the wider area whenever needed.

Nicky re-joined Wiltshire Police in 2021, having previously served for 11 years with West Midlands Police.

What she enjoys most about neighbourhood policing is the opportunity to work closely with the community - not just in a policing capacity, but also by participating in local events throughout the year. Nicky values the strong sense of community spirit and takes pride in being part of the events that bring people together.

PCSO Jonathan Mills has been serving with Wiltshire Police for 19 years. With extensive experience, Jonathan brings a deep understanding of community-focused policing to his role covering the Vale of Pewsey.

Jonathan particularly enjoys working within the neighbourhood team and takes pride in advising local residents on how to protect their property, especially through the use of modern technology. His commitment to supporting the community and enhancing safety makes him a trusted and approachable figure in the Vale of Pewsey.
